TRI Toxic Chemical Releases
Annual pounds of each toxic chemical released to air, water, and land, as reported to the EPA Toxic Release Inventory. Carcinogen (♦) and PFAS designations are per EPA and IARC classifications.
| Year | Total Releases (lbs) | vs Prior Year |
|---|---|---|
| 2015 | 3,078,862 | — |
| 2016 | 3,697,996 | +20% |
| 2017 | 3,743,363 | +1% |
| 2018 | 3,980,413 | +6% |
| 2019 | 4,492,105 | +13% |
| 2020 | 4,317,534 | -4% |
| 2021 | 3,465,097 | -20% |
| 2022 | 4,849,373 | +40% |
| 2023 | 5,820,835 | +20% |
| 2024 | 6,057,031 | +4% |
